Taken
Taken zijn te beheren via de controller 'task'.
list
Middels deze functie kunt u een lijst met taken ophalen die voldoen aan de meegegeven parameters.
Invoerparameters:
| Veldnaam | Waarde | Omschrijving |
|---|---|---|
| referenceId | int | Gekoppelde entiteits ID |
| referenceType | string | Aan taken te koppelen entiteitstype, zie variabelen-lijst |
| status | string | Taak status, zie variabelen-lijst |
| offset | int | Standaard: 0 |
| limit | int | Standaard: 1000 |
| sort | string | Standaard: DueAtDate |
| order | 'ASC' of 'DESC' | Standaard: DESC |
| searchat | string | Welke velden doorzocht moeten worden. Standaard: Title|Description |
| searchfor | string | Zoekterm |
Voorbeeld invoer:
$parameters = [
"status" => "open"
];
$api->sendRequest('task', 'list', $parameters);
Voorbeeld uitvoer:
Array
(
[controller] => task
[action] => list
[status] => success
[date] => 2024-01-21T12:00:00+02:00
[totalresults] => 1
[currentresults] => 1
[offset] => 0
[filters] => Array
(
[status] => open
)
[tasks] => Array
(
[0] => Array
(
[Identifier] => 1
[DueAt] =>
[DueAtTime] =>
[CompletedAt] => 0000-00-00 00:00:00
[AssigneeId] =>
[DebtorId] =>
[DebtorContactId] =>
[CreditorId] =>
[InvoiceId] =>
[PriceQuoteId] =>
[CreditInvoiceId] =>
[UnprocessedCreditInvoiceId] =>
[SubscriptionId] =>
[Title] => Example task
[Description] => Example description
[CreatedByEmployeeId] =>
[Status] => open
[Created] => 2024-01-21 11:00:00
[Modified] => 2024-01-21 11:00:00
)
)
)